Todd Archer of ESPN Dallas reports that the Cowboys have signed first-round pick OL Zack Martin to a four-year contract on Monday.
Dallas now has all of their 2014 draft picks under contract except second-round selection DE/OLB Demarcus Lawrence.
Martin’s four-year contract is worth an estimated $8,967,798 which includes a signing bonus of $4,842,036, according to OverTheCap.com.
The Cowboys have been lining Martin up at right guard during OTAs, although he has taken a few reps at center as well. He offers plenty of versatility, and could eventually takeover for Doug Free at right tackle.
